// Client setup for the Lanternkit component registry.
//
// Lanternkit follows strict semver: snapshot builds publish under the
// `canary` dist-tag, and stable releases are cut only from tagged commits.
// This client resolves component versions against the internal registry
// at startup and caches the manifest for one hour. Reviewers: note that
// the credential is injected at deploy time in production; this constant
// exists only for the sandbox environment. Initialize the registry client
// with the key below.

gateway credential: kto23_LX9A4ys6i4nzHtpOLNLodKK

# RateLens Environments

Quick overview for release purposes. RateLens (our hotel rate-parity checker) runs in three environments: dev, staging, and prod. Dev scrapes the sandbox feeds only, staging hits real partner feeds at reduced frequency, and prod runs the full crawl schedule. Promotions go dev → staging → prod, no skipping. For reference, staging currently runs with the following configuration.

config for hawif-bawef:
[tamix]
host = tamix.zarqelgrid.corp
user = tamix_svc
database = tamix_prod

// GARAGE_FEED_STALE_LIMIT_MS defines how old an occupancy reading from the
// Stallpoint garage sensors may be before the Lotwise app marks a level as
// "unknown" instead of showing counts. Support note: when customers report
// frozen spot counts at the Bricker Avenue garage, the feed has usually
// exceeded this limit and the app is behaving as designed — escalate to the
// sensor ops team at Parkhaven, not the app team. The build this threshold
// last changed in is recorded below.

build token for fajof-yahof: htk4_869f

Handover note — Pinefold static rebuilds

Taking over from me tonight: the incremental rebuild pipeline on Pinefold is mostly stable, but the dependency graph cache occasionally goes stale after a content-model change, and pages rebuild with old templates. Fix is to flush the graph cache and trigger a partial rebuild — full rebuilds take four hours, avoid them. The flush tool asks for the maintenance vault passphrase before it'll run, which I've put below.

vault phrase of tajef-tafog = istox-sorax-zorox-casok-holox-kelix-weneth-drueth-casion